Transaction 6388fd53c127f682b6a604fdf9eeec4851099b151eba3f309527ef5f63a8a2a1
1 Input
1 Output
-
6388fd53c127f682b6a604fdf9eeec4851099b151eba3f309527ef5f63a8a2a1:0
- value
- 22684622
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1962009e259c9724abc0ff07a33d2f66cc5b7b57 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13KDJ886pLEyqUVb8kpypwwUpPAXdaTLPc